Home
last modified time | relevance | path

Searched refs:pgsize (Results 1 – 18 of 18) sorted by relevance

/Linux-v4.19/drivers/mtd/tests/
Dpagetest.c46 static int pgsize; variable
78 for (j = 0; j < pgcnt - 1; ++j, addr += pgsize) { in verify_eraseblock()
90 if (memcmp(twopages, writebuf + (j * pgsize), bufsize)) { in verify_eraseblock()
97 if (addr <= addrn - pgsize - pgsize && !bbt[ebnum + 1]) { in verify_eraseblock()
111 memcpy(boundary, writebuf + mtd->erasesize - pgsize, pgsize); in verify_eraseblock()
112 prandom_bytes_state(&rnd_state, boundary + pgsize, pgsize); in verify_eraseblock()
130 pp1 = kcalloc(pgsize, 4, GFP_KERNEL); in crosstest()
133 pp2 = pp1 + pgsize; in crosstest()
134 pp3 = pp2 + pgsize; in crosstest()
135 pp4 = pp3 + pgsize; in crosstest()
[all …]
Dtorturetest.c82 static int pgsize; variable
109 addr = (loff_t)(ebnum + 1) * mtd->erasesize - pgcnt * pgsize; in check_eraseblock()
110 len = pgcnt * pgsize; in check_eraseblock()
163 addr = (loff_t)(ebnum + 1) * mtd->erasesize - pgcnt * pgsize; in write_pattern()
164 len = pgcnt * pgsize; in write_pattern()
215 pgsize = 512; in tort_init()
217 pgsize = mtd->writesize; in tort_init()
219 if (pgcnt && (pgcnt > mtd->erasesize / pgsize || pgcnt < 0)) { in tort_init()
249 for (i = 0; i < mtd->erasesize / pgsize; i++) { in tort_init()
251 memset(patt_5A5 + i * pgsize, 0x55, pgsize); in tort_init()
[all …]
Dspeedtest.c49 static int pgsize; variable
89 err = mtdtest_write(mtd, addr, pgsize, buf); in write_eraseblock_by_page()
92 addr += pgsize; in write_eraseblock_by_page()
93 buf += pgsize; in write_eraseblock_by_page()
101 size_t sz = pgsize * 2; in write_eraseblock_by_2pages()
114 err = mtdtest_write(mtd, addr, pgsize, buf); in write_eraseblock_by_2pages()
133 err = mtdtest_read(mtd, addr, pgsize, buf); in read_eraseblock_by_page()
136 addr += pgsize; in read_eraseblock_by_page()
137 buf += pgsize; in read_eraseblock_by_page()
145 size_t sz = pgsize * 2; in read_eraseblock_by_2pages()
[all …]
Dreadtest.c43 static int pgsize; variable
55 memset(buf, 0 , pgsize); in read_eraseblock_by_page()
56 ret = mtdtest_read(mtd, addr, pgsize, buf); in read_eraseblock_by_page()
84 addr += pgsize; in read_eraseblock_by_page()
85 buf += pgsize; in read_eraseblock_by_page()
150 pgsize = 512; in mtd_readtest_init()
152 pgsize = mtd->writesize; in mtd_readtest_init()
157 pgcnt = mtd->erasesize / pgsize; in mtd_readtest_init()
163 pgsize, ebcnt, pgcnt, mtd->oobsize); in mtd_readtest_init()
Dstresstest.c50 static int pgsize; variable
116 len = ((len + pgsize - 1) / pgsize) * pgsize; in do_write()
175 pgsize = 512; in mtd_stresstest_init()
177 pgsize = mtd->writesize; in mtd_stresstest_init()
182 pgcnt = mtd->erasesize / pgsize; in mtd_stresstest_init()
188 pgsize, ebcnt, pgcnt, mtd->oobsize); in mtd_stresstest_init()
/Linux-v4.19/arch/arm64/mm/
Dhugetlbpage.c55 pte_t *ptep, size_t *pgsize) in find_num_contig() argument
61 *pgsize = PAGE_SIZE; in find_num_contig()
65 *pgsize = PMD_SIZE; in find_num_contig()
71 static inline int num_contig_ptes(unsigned long size, size_t *pgsize) in num_contig_ptes() argument
75 *pgsize = size; in num_contig_ptes()
85 *pgsize = PMD_SIZE; in num_contig_ptes()
89 *pgsize = PAGE_SIZE; in num_contig_ptes()
108 unsigned long pgsize, in get_clear_flush() argument
115 for (i = 0; i < ncontig; i++, addr += pgsize, ptep++) { in get_clear_flush()
149 unsigned long pgsize, in clear_flush() argument
[all …]
/Linux-v4.19/tools/testing/selftests/powerpc/tm/
Dtm-vmxcopy.c39 unsigned long pgsize = getpagesize(); in test_vmxcopy() local
42 int size = pgsize*16; in test_vmxcopy()
44 char buf[pgsize]; in test_vmxcopy()
54 memset(buf, 0, pgsize); in test_vmxcopy()
55 for (i = 0; i < size; i += pgsize) in test_vmxcopy()
56 assert(write(fd, buf, pgsize) == pgsize); in test_vmxcopy()
/Linux-v4.19/drivers/gpu/drm/etnaviv/
Detnaviv_mmu.c18 size_t pgsize = SZ_4K; in etnaviv_domain_unmap() local
20 if (!IS_ALIGNED(iova | size, pgsize)) { in etnaviv_domain_unmap()
22 iova, size, pgsize); in etnaviv_domain_unmap()
27 unmapped_page = domain->ops->unmap(domain, iova, pgsize); in etnaviv_domain_unmap()
41 size_t pgsize = SZ_4K; in etnaviv_domain_map() local
45 if (!IS_ALIGNED(iova | paddr | size, pgsize)) { in etnaviv_domain_map()
47 iova, &paddr, size, pgsize); in etnaviv_domain_map()
52 ret = domain->ops->map(domain, iova, paddr, pgsize, prot); in etnaviv_domain_map()
56 iova += pgsize; in etnaviv_domain_map()
57 paddr += pgsize; in etnaviv_domain_map()
[all …]
/Linux-v4.19/drivers/iommu/
Diommu.c1517 size_t pgsize; in iommu_pgsize() local
1530 pgsize = (1UL << (pgsize_idx + 1)) - 1; in iommu_pgsize()
1533 pgsize &= domain->pgsize_bitmap; in iommu_pgsize()
1536 BUG_ON(!pgsize); in iommu_pgsize()
1539 pgsize_idx = __fls(pgsize); in iommu_pgsize()
1540 pgsize = 1UL << pgsize_idx; in iommu_pgsize()
1542 return pgsize; in iommu_pgsize()
1578 size_t pgsize = iommu_pgsize(domain, iova | paddr, size); in iommu_map() local
1581 iova, &paddr, pgsize); in iommu_map()
1583 ret = domain->ops->map(domain, iova, paddr, pgsize, prot); in iommu_map()
[all …]
Dio-pgtable-arm.c1157 static const unsigned long pgsize[] = { in arm_lpae_do_selftests() local
1174 for (i = 0; i < ARRAY_SIZE(pgsize); ++i) { in arm_lpae_do_selftests()
1176 cfg.pgsize_bitmap = pgsize[i]; in arm_lpae_do_selftests()
1179 pgsize[i], ias[j]); in arm_lpae_do_selftests()
/Linux-v4.19/arch/powerpc/kvm/
Dbook3s_64_mmu.c231 int pgsize; in kvmppc_mmu_book3s_64_xlate() local
267 pgsize = slbe->large ? MMU_PAGE_16M : MMU_PAGE_4K; in kvmppc_mmu_book3s_64_xlate()
296 pgsize = decode_pagesize(slbe, pte1); in kvmppc_mmu_book3s_64_xlate()
297 if (pgsize < 0) in kvmppc_mmu_book3s_64_xlate()
322 eaddr_mask = (1ull << mmu_pagesize(pgsize)) - 1; in kvmppc_mmu_book3s_64_xlate()
324 gpte->page_size = pgsize; in kvmppc_mmu_book3s_64_xlate()
De500.h166 unsigned int pgsize = get_tlb_size(tlbe); in get_tlb_bytes() local
167 return 1ULL << 10 << pgsize; in get_tlb_bytes()
Dbook3s_64_vio_hv.c225 const unsigned long pgsize = 1ULL << tbl->it_page_shift; in kvmppc_rm_tce_iommu_mapped_dec() local
232 mem = mm_iommu_lookup_rm(kvm->mm, be64_to_cpu(*pua), pgsize); in kvmppc_rm_tce_iommu_mapped_dec()
Dbook3s_64_vio.c378 const unsigned long pgsize = 1ULL << tbl->it_page_shift; in kvmppc_tce_iommu_mapped_dec() local
385 mem = mm_iommu_lookup(kvm->mm, be64_to_cpu(*pua), pgsize); in kvmppc_tce_iommu_mapped_dec()
Dbook3s_64_mmu_hv.c204 static inline unsigned long hpte0_pgsize_encoding(unsigned long pgsize) in hpte0_pgsize_encoding() argument
206 return (pgsize > 0x1000) ? HPTE_V_LARGE : 0; in hpte0_pgsize_encoding()
210 static inline unsigned long hpte1_pgsize_encoding(unsigned long pgsize) in hpte1_pgsize_encoding() argument
212 return (pgsize == 0x10000) ? 0x1000 : 0; in hpte1_pgsize_encoding()
/Linux-v4.19/drivers/s390/char/
Dsclp_diag.h51 u8 pgsize; member
Dsclp_ftp.c108 sccb->evbuf.mdd.ftp.pgsize = 0; in sclp_ftp_et7()
/Linux-v4.19/arch/ia64/kernel/
Dhead.S165 #define SET_ONE_RR(num, pgsize, _tmp1, _tmp2, vhpt) \ argument
167 mov _tmp2=((ia64_rid(IA64_REGION_ID_KERNEL, (num<<61)) << 8) | (pgsize << 2) | vhpt);; \